Race to the Olympics
Mon, Jul 21, 2008
The Straits Times

IF YOU have only just decided to go to the Olympics in Beijing: On your marks, get set, go! You will need to hotfoot it now to a travel agent.

There were some packages that included tickets to the games left when Life! checked.

That is great news for Singapore's Olympics squad, who will lap up all the homeside cheers they can get when they compete.

But the bad news is, the packages are being offered by only three out of 15 tour agencies checked.

Agents who opted not to go for Olympic gold said it was impossible to snare tickets for the mega sporting event, plus arranging tourist visas to be approved was a hassle, and the prices of airfares and hotel rooms were sky-high.

Some Singaporeans have already won their Olympic race, though.

Take sports-lover May Loh, 40, who readily forked out more than $3,000 - twice the normal price for a jaunt to Beijing - to achieve her Olympic dream of seeing the event live.
